#jit

2021-5-5 20:59
Cinder是Instagram' S的内部性能型生产版本的PyThon 3.8。它包含许多性能优化,包括CONETECODE内联的缓存,渴望评估考程,A-A-timeJIT,以及使用类型注释的实验数据,用于在JIT中执行更好的Emittype专用字节码。 我们' ve of to puin......
2021-4-8 16:43
MIR - 由Redhat GCC维护者开发的C中的新JIT后端 NJ - 基于Eclipse OMR中的C ++编写的JIT引擎。 Eclipse OMR用于IBM' S Java实现,但JIT引擎是通用的 Moonjit - Lua编程语言的正常编译器。 罗吉特叉继续发展 Ravi - ......
2021-4-8 3:15
此功能目前正在预览中。预览功能未被语义版本控制涵盖,有些细节可能会随着我们继续优化它们而变化。 TaiLwind CSS V2.1为TaiLwind CSS引入了一个新的立交式编译器,用于当您创作模板时,为您的模板而不是在初始构建时间之前提前生成所有内容。 闪电快速建设时间。 TaiLwind可以使用3-8秒......
2021-4-2 9:2
新编程语言的实施中的优势来自interpretation,因为它很简单,灵活,便携。 唯一筹码是执行速度,因为甚至有效的解释器和系统之间仍然存在大的PerformanceGAP,包括包括just-the-time(JIT)编译器。 然而,用JIT加强翻译,不是一项小任务。 如今,Java JITS通常是基于方法。 要......
2020-12-6 20:1
MIR项目的目标是为实现快速,轻量级的口译员和JIT提供基础 该代码处于开发的初始阶段。仅用于熟悉项目。绝对没有保证将来不会更改MIR,并且该代码适用于任何测试,除了此处给出的测试以及在x86_64 Linux / OSX和aarch64 / ppc64be / ppc64le / s390x Linux以外的平......
A First Look at the JIT(blog.erlang.org)
2020-11-5 2:6
这个问题在很大程度上是自己造成的,是由于编译器太慢(我们经常使用LLVM)造成的,而我们给它提供了大段代码来进行更多的优化,这让情况变得更糟。 通过限制自己一次只编译一条指令,我们在表上留下了一些性能,但极大地提高了编译速度。 这使得编译速度非常快,因为我们基本上只是在每次使用指令时复制-粘贴模板,仅根据其参数执行一......
2020-9-26 1:2
谷歌在網路論壇中,您可以建立並參與線上論壇及電子郵件群組,體驗最精彩的社群交流。
2020-9-25 23:22
‪српски(ћирилица)‬
2020-9-10 13:8
这是关于JIT编译器系列文章的第一篇。我们的计划是采用一种简单的输入语言,并为其开发一些解释器和JIT,其复杂程度大致递增。我希望在本系列结束时,读者能够很好地理解开发JIT编译器需要什么,以及有哪些工具可以帮助完成这项任务。 输入语言将是Brainfuck,或BF,因为我将从现在起和整个系列中都会提到它。我认为这是......
JITSploitation I: A JIT Bug(googleprojectzero.blogspot.com)
2020-9-3 7:7
本系列由三部分组成,重点介绍了查找和利用现代Web浏览器中的JavaScript引擎漏洞所涉及的技术挑战,并评估了当前的漏洞利用缓解技术。被利用的漏洞CVE-2020-9802已在iOS 13.5中修复,而两个缓解绕过(CVE-2020-9870和CVE-2020-9910)已在iOS 13.6中修复。 2020年浏......
2020-7-6 3:2
如果您熟悉JIT的一般工作方式(如果您理解了标题所指的内容),我建议您略读这篇文章,或者直接阅读JIT编译器是如何实现和快速的:Julia、PyPy、LuaJIT、Graal等。 我的导师克里斯把我从“什么是JIT”带到了我现在所处的位置,他曾经告诉我,编译器只是以字节为单位输出的,根本不是低级的和可怕的。这实际上是......
2020-7-3 4:28
PermalLink GitHub是5000多万开发人员的家园,他们一起工作,共同托管和审查代码、管理项目和构建软件。 报名。 这本质上是一个JIT,其中代码只被使用一次,然后被覆盖并再次使用。(请注意,此代码在实施W^X安全性的操作系统上不起作用。目前,x86上使用最广泛的操作系统不强制执行W^X,因此上述技术在大......
2020-7-2 18:54
PermalLink GitHub是5000多万开发人员的家园,他们一起工作,共同托管和审查代码、管理项目和构建软件。 报名。 这本质上是一个JIT,其中代码只被使用一次,然后被覆盖并再次使用。(请注意,此代码在实施W^X安全性的操作系统上不起作用。目前,x86上使用最广泛的操作系统不强制执行W^X,因此上述技术在大......